Library Usability Links 1/16/09

  • Smashing Magazine has a comprehensive article on Mobile Web Design with discussion, pointers, and screen shots of good design. This chart on screen sizes caught my eye:
    • mobile-screen-sizes
  • Jared Spool has an interesting case study on a usability project that discovered the existence of a $300 million button.
  • Here’s another mouse tracker, which  makes use of javascript on your page to track user behavior, called  userfly.
  • Swype is a fascinatingly usable  interface for mobile devices. Check out the video.
  • Mashable.com has a good overview of what Usability is not. I especially like number eight, which is a crucial point for smaller libraries.
  • On the flipside, Library WebHead points to the Darien Library which has its own UX Department.
  • In the UK, one group of library administrators want to rebrand their librarians as “Audience Development Officers“, which I doubt is a user-centered label.
